John Keells Properties celebrated the beginning of construction for their newest development, Tri-Zen aparments at the site in Union Place last week.

Deputy Chairman and the Group Finance Director of John Keells Holdings PLC Gihan Cooray, President of John Keells Property Sector, Suresh Rajendra, Sector Head, John Keells Properties, Nayana Mawilmada, Joint Venture partners Chairman of Indra Traders (Pvt) Ltd., Indra Silva, and Managing Director, Indra Traders (Pvt) Ltd Rushanka Silva and officials from construction partners China State Engineering were also present.

Head of Sector at John Keells Properties, Nayana Mawilmada said, “This is good time for both local and foreign investors to invest in the property market in Sri Lanka. Potential investors for TRI-ZEN can rest easy with the assurance that the development will not be subject to forex rate-based price variations. This was a strategic decision on our part to overcome volatility in international currency markets and deliver value to our customers.” Chairman, Indra Traders (Pvt) Ltd., Indra Silva said, “This is our first venture into a major property development, and we are excited that construction is now under way on this very ambitious project.”

“With John Keells Properties as our joint venture partner, and China State Construction Engineering Corporation as the contractor, Tri-Zen will prove to be an exceptional success, and an excellent investment for those looking for comfort and convenience in the city,” he said.
